Obama had previously said that UFO sightings by the military “must be taken seriously."

Speaking on James Corden’s The Late Late Show last week, the former president said he had seen the recently-released footage of UFOs harassing US military targets. 

“What is true... is that there's footage and records of objects in the skies that we don't know exactly what they are,” Obama said.

“We can't explain how they moved, their trajectory… they did not have an easily explainable pattern.

“So I think that people still take seriously trying to investigate and figure out what that is. But I have nothing to report to you today.”

Obama also admitted that when he was inaugurated, he asked about the possibility of UFOs.

“Look, the truth is that when I came into office I asked," he told Corden.

“I was like, 'All right, is there the lab somewhere where we're keeping the alien specimens and spaceships?'

Congress passed legislation in December, mandating the Department of Defense and the National Intelligence Director to produce a report about “Unidentified Aerial Phenomena” within six months. 

and is expected to contain everything the US Government knows about UAPs.

It's thought that the document could arrive as early as today - June 1.

It will examine if unidentified aerial phenomena constitute a threat to US airspace,  reports.

The report is unlikely to conclude that highly advanced extraterrestrials are the cause but it may not rule them out.

It's expected that recommendations for further UFO research and funding will be included within the dossier.
